Congrats on your new speakers. I have Summits and I was listening to 20.1s and they are some fantastic speakers. So I take it that you felt you really had to move way up the line for the maggies to outperform the Ascent i's???

It was a matter of size and my room - It's small @ 13' x 13' x 9'. I think anything bigger than the 1.6s would be too big (1.6s were actually at about the limit). The Ascents, although as tall, are not as wide and don't dominate the room like the Maggies.

Hey - I figured those questions would come. I didn't want to spill all the beans in one post and then have nothing else to say...

2 Channel only
Jolida JD100 CDP
Krell 400xi integrated

As far as the comparison to the Maggies, all things considered I'm glad I made the move. BUT - I do now realize just how good the Maggies are for the price.
Right now, the MLs do acoustic and 'simple' music better (vocals, piano, etc.). The Maggies did complex music better, but I'm confident that's because 1. The MLs aren't set up yet, and 2. The electronics aren't doing them justice.
I was amazed at how tilting the Ascents back a half inch or so changed the sound significantly. I got lots of work to do.
